Results for Saint Thomas More Parish Houston

Loading Results
Related Searches
saint thomas more parish houston
st thomas more parish school houston
st thomas more houston
st. thomas more catholic church houston
st thomas more houston tx
st. thomas more catholic church houston tx
saint thomas more parish
st thomas more catholic school houston
st thomas more catholic school houston tx
st. thomas more parish
Loading Additional Information